Expect moving costs from Wyoming to Delaware to vary based on your household size and service needs. Small moves generally range from $1,687 to $1,772, medium moves from $1,940 to $2,038, and large moves from $2,193 to $2,304. Prices fluctuate due to distance, volume of belongings, and additional services like packing or storage. Comparing quotes ensures you find the best fit for your budget and timeline.

Standard delivery takes about 4 days, while expedited options can reduce this to 3 days. Actual timing depends on the moving company’s schedule and route logistics.
Choosing a self-service move or flexible delivery dates can lower costs. However, full-service moves offer convenience but at a higher price. Comparing quotes helps identify the most affordable option for your needs.
Booking at least 4 to 6 weeks in advance is recommended to secure preferred dates and rates. Last-minute bookings may result in higher prices or limited availability.
Yes, moving companies operating between states must hold valid interstate licenses to comply with federal regulations, ensuring professional and legal service.
